i've had a bouncy idle for about a month now, thats been getting progressively worse. its only during cold start and i've already replaced the iacv and cleaned out the pcv valve. what else am i missing? i started out by cleaning the original iacv with some carb cleaner and ive been told not to but to use electrical cleaner.. the iacv i replaced it with is from a y8 (my engine is a z6), are the not interchangeable? im also considering replacing my pcv valve with the y8 pcv (since i have the whole y8 im), are they different? its frustrating that ive done 2 things that should've fixed it, replacing the iacv and cleaning the pcv valve (i've also checked for vacuum leaks). help me please!

engine: d16z6 obd1 (obviously) no cel
mods: t3 turbo kit/dsm 450's/missing link

i had the SAME problem a year ago... everyone says IACV and crap but the IACV only controls when ur car is warmed up and idling... but when your car is warming up, you actually have the FITV controlling the idle. theres a lil plastic screw thing in it that gets loose over time and u need to open the FITV and just tighten the screw, They say its not recommended to open it instead u should replace it but couple people i know opened it including me and fixed the problem.
